Honor Launches 500 Series: A Premium Mid-Range Refresh
Honor has officially launched its new Honor 500 series in China, marking a significant refresh with a stylish new design, enhanced battery life, and upgraded hardware across its lineup. The introduction of the Honor 500 and Honor 500 Pro illustrates the brand’s commitment to competing in the mid-range smartphone market, blending flagship elements with affordability.
Design and Build Quality
The design of the Honor 500 series stands out with its sleek aluminum frames and glass backs, reminiscent of Apple’s recent aesthetic trends. The camera layout notably parallels the design found in the iPhone Air models, showcasing Honor’s ambition to elevate its brand perception. While the Honor 500 and 500 Pro are slightly bulkier at 198g and 201g respectively, they maintain a trim profile of just 7.8mm. Both devices do not compromise on durability, retaining their predecessor’s full IP68 and IP69K water and dust resistance ratings.
Display Features
Users can expect a stunning visual experience, as both models feature a 6.55-inch LTPO OLED display, boasting a resolution of 1,264 x 2,736 pixels. With a 120Hz refresh rate and an impressive 6,000 nits of peak local brightness, the screens are designed for exceptional clarity and fluidity. The in-display fingerprint scanner adds to the modern user experience, alongside a robust 50MP front-facing camera for high-quality selfies.
Performance and Photography
When it comes to performance, there is a notable distinction between the two models. The Honor 500 is powered by the Snapdragon 8s Gen 4 chipset, while the more robust Honor 500 Pro features the Snapdragon 8 Elite. The Pro model can also be equipped with up to 16GB of RAM and 1TB of internal storage, catering to power users and tech enthusiasts alike. Each phone is equipped with a formidable 200MP main camera featuring a 1/1.4-inch sensor, complemented by a 12MP ultrawide lens. The Pro version is elevated further with an additional 50MP telephoto camera, providing 3x optical zoom for more versatile photography.
Battery Technology
Honor has made significant strides in battery technology this year, integrating an impressive 8,000mAh Si-C battery into both devices. This robust battery supports 80W wired charging, ensuring minimal downtime. The Pro model offers further convenience with support for 50W wireless charging and both phones facilitate up to 27W reverse wired charging. Running on MagicOS 10 based on Android 16, the user experience is set to be seamless.
Color Options and Pricing
The Honor 500 series will be available in several appealing colors, including Aquamarine, Starlight Powder, Moonlight Silver, and Obsidian Black. Pre-orders are open now in China, with the first devices expected to ship on November 27.
Official Pricing in China:
| Configuration | Honor 500 | Honor 500 Pro |
|---|---|---|
| 12GB/256GB | CNY 2,699 ($380) | CNY 3,599 ($506) |
| 12GB/512GB | CNY 2,999 ($422) | CNY 3,899 ($549) |
| 16GB/512GB | CNY 3,299 ($646) | CNY 4,199 ($590) |
| 16GB/1TB | – | CNY 4,799 ($675) |
